Practical overview

Roblox Evomon changes character at level 30. That is when the account stops being only about basic island clearing and starts demanding a little more intention: Ultimate timing, cap management, quest gating, and material planning.

Most beginner frustration here comes from misreading the wall. Players often think the game suddenly became grindy, when the real issue is that the route changed. Ascension has to be handled, the evolution kiosk matters, and Lava Crag becomes the first true material farm instead of just another map.

SituationGoalRouteInvestmentNext moveCaution
The level-30 checkpointUnderstand why this level matters so muchLevel 30 is the first real power spike in current Roblox Evomon. It unlocks the Ultimate Move, adds the yellow Ultimate Gauge under your health and energy bars, and often marks the point where basic auto-pilot stops being enough.A milestone mindset shift.Start learning when to save your Ultimate instead of firing it the moment the bar lights up.Treating level 30 like just another number makes you miss the biggest early combat upgrade in the current release.
The Ascension gateAvoid 'why am I not gaining XP?' confusionIf your team suddenly stops gaining levels, check the Quest Log before blaming a bug. The current roadmap says Ascension quests are what raise your account-level cap, and ignoring them is the fastest way to misread the whole progression system.One quest-log check and clear.Clear the gate first, then resume leveling or evolution prep with confidence.Grinding past a hidden cap is one of the most frustrating avoidable loops for new players.
First evolution prepShow up to Skyheart Isle preparedDo not walk into the Evolution Kiosk empty-handed. Current public routing says the first serious evolution prep wants Rainbow Stones, matching type materials, and enough level progress that the kiosk visit actually converts into a jump instead of a disappointment.One materials checklist.If the real missing piece is Lava Crag farming, pivot there deliberately instead of guessing what the kiosk still wants.Most 'evolution is stuck' frustration is really 'materials and quest gates were not planned yet.'
Lava Crag material phasePrepare for Tier 2 without panicOnce Petal Pond is solved, Lava Crag becomes the first real material farm. Current public routing calls out the mount requirement, trainer arena gem farming, shard combination, and a practical checklist of 3 matching gems, 20 Rainbow Stones, and 12 shards before the next serious evolution push.A focused material session.Return to the kiosk only when the bag is actually ready.Walking into Lava Crag underleveled or with the wrong team types makes the whole evolution phase feel meaner than the route intends.

Decision table

Use this section when the guide stops being theory and turns into a real choice you need to make on your account right now.

SituationActionReason
Your monsters stopped gaining levelsCheck the Ascension quest immediatelyThe current route says cap gates are a progression mechanic, not a bug.
You unlocked an Ultimate but fights still feel messyLearn when to hold it for the real damage windowUltimates are strongest when timed, not when used instantly.
The kiosk still will not give you the jump you wantRecheck materials and level thresholds before more grindingEvolution frustration is usually a checklist issue before it is a difficulty issue.
Lava Crag is opening up but feels hostileFix your team types and mount situation firstThat biome punishes the wrong preparation much harder than the first two islands do.

Level 30 Evolution mistakes to avoid

These are the habits that most often make a readable Roblox Evomon beginner route feel heavier and slower than it needs to.

Ignoring the Quest Log after hitting a level gate.

Spending important stones or shards on the wrong monster because the bag felt full.

Using Ultimates on low-value targets just because the button is available.

Walking into Lava Crag without a plan for type matchups or movement.

Level 30 Evolution FAQ

Short answers for the specific Roblox Evomon beginner question this page is built to solve.

Why does level 30 feel like such a big breakpoint in Roblox Evomon?

Because it unlocks the Ultimate system and often coincides with the first serious level-cap and evolution planning pressure on the account.

What should I do if XP gain seems to stop suddenly?

Check whether an Ascension quest is now gating your account. The current public route treats that as the normal explanation before anything else.

When should I start farming Lava Crag?

After Petal Pond is under control and your team is stable enough to handle level-30-plus pressure without turning every run into a wipe.
